If declined card affects Apple Search Ads account

If your card is declined, Apple Search Ads will pause your ads and try to charge the same card again within 48 hours.

Your ads won't run until issues with your card are resolved, so make sure to fix the problem as soon as possible.

If you add a replacement credit or debit card to your account, Apple will charge the new card within 24 hours of updating the card information.

You can't ask Apple to manually run charges, so just wait for the automated process to take care of it.

What is an unauthorized Apple charge?

An unauthorized Apple charge is a transaction that occurs on your Apple account without your permission.

It can be a one-time charge or a recurring subscription that you never signed up for.

These charges often appear on your Apple account as a purchase or subscription from an unknown or unfamiliar store.

According to Apple's policies, unauthorized charges can be disputed and refunded.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a payment from Apple.com bill?

A payment from Apple.com bill is for purchases made through Apple, including apps, subscriptions, music, movies, and more. Check your statement for details on what you've been charged for.

How to cancel Apple.com bill charges?

To cancel Apple.com bill charges, sign in to your Apple account, go to Subscriptions, and select the subscription you want to cancel. From there, click "Cancel Subscription" to stop recurring payments.
